Analytics Engineer

New Today

Overview

Analytics Engineer role at Blink - Employee Experience Platform. You will bridge data infrastructure and analytics, turning raw data into trusted, well-modelled datasets that power decision-making. Initially you may own end-to-end responsibilities, with a plan to grow a team around you in a scaleup environment.

We’re a fast-growing company on a big mission: to unlock the potential of every person, team, and organization. Our analytics aim to be a core driver of decision-making, turning customer data into actionable insights across employee engagement, turnover, surveys, shift booking, and payslips through our all-in-one app.

Key Responsibilities

  • Build, maintain, and optimize data transformations, models, and pipelines in dbt (or equivalent) with testing, documentation, and version control
  • Define, own, and monitor business metrics and models (e.g. dimension tables, slowly changing dimensions, aggregates)
  • Collaborate with analysts, BI users, data scientists, and business stakeholders to translate data requirements into reliable data products (tables, views, metrics)
  • Ensure data quality, consistency, and observability (tests, monitoring, alerting)
  • Optimize SQL queries and transformations for performance in the data warehouse / lakehouse
  • Support or own CI/CD workflows around analytics (e.g. git, reviews, deployment of transformation code)
  • Build or maintain upstream data pipelines or ingestion processes when required

Requirements

  • Strong proficiency in SQL - writing and optimizing complex queries, joins, window functions, performance tuning
  • Experience with dbt (or equivalent) - building models, tests, documentation, version control
  • Understanding of data warehousing concepts (star schemas, snowflake, slowly changing dimensions, partitioning, clustering)
  • Experience in a modern data stack (e.g. BigQuery, Snowflake, Redshift, Databricks, etc.)
  • Comfortable working downstream (with BI/analytics users) and upstream (pipelines, ingestion) contexts
  • Familiarity with BI tools (Thoughtspot, Power BI)
  • Proficient in Python
  • Solid software engineering skills, including version control, testing, and CI/CD
  • Versatile and adaptable - able to work across the stack and learn new tools quickly
  • Strong communication with technical and non-technical stakeholders
  • Experience in a lean or startup environment is a plus

Benefits

  • Competitive salary and equity
  • Office in London with natural light
  • 25 days off per year (plus public holidays)
  • Learning & development focus with mentorship options
  • Private healthcare, Ride2Work, pension scheme

At Blink, we’re committed to an inclusive and diverse culture with fair and equal consideration for all applications.

#J-18808-Ljbffr
Location:
City Of London
Job Type:
FullTime
Category:
IT & Technology

We found some similar jobs based on your search